WebSlate has microscopic clay and mica crystals that have grown perpendicular to the maximum stress direction. Slate tends to break into flat sheets or plates, a property described as slaty cleavage. Figure 10.14 Slate, a low-grade foliated metamorphic rock. Left- Slate fragments resulting from rock cleavage. Right- The same rock type in outcrop. WebSome minerals, such as mica, only cleavage in only one direction. They tend to break into thin, flat sheets. Salt, which is also known as the mineral halite, has cleavage in three directions. This causes the salt to break into cubes. A model to show how cleavage works. You can get an idea of how these weaknesses work by tearing a paper towel. Web15. Foliated metamorphic rocks will split along cleavage lines that are parallel to the minerals that make up the rock. Slate, as an example, will split into thin sheets. Foliate comes from the Latin word that means sheets, as in the sheets of paper in a book. how healthy is canned foodWebMar 22, 2024 · Mica is a mineral that will cleave into flat sheets.
